Anker Offers USB-C to Lightning Cables

Anker is the next company to present a range of MFi USB-C to Lightning cables-- the Powerline and Powerline+, described by the company as being among the most durable cables available on the market.

Available in either 90cm or 1.8m lengths, the cables promise extra strenght and a bend lifespan reaching over 5x compared to other cables. The Powerline USB-C to Lightning cable is covered in aramid fibre, while the Powerline+ model is encased in aluminium and reinforced in braided nylon, making it the toughest option.

A First EVGA Sound Card

PC component maker EVGA joins forces with Audio Note UK to present a first sound card-- the NU Audio Card, a shielded PCIe card promising "the most immersive audio and lifelike gaming experienced on a PC."

EVGA claims the NU Audio Card offers audiophile-grade audio quality, allowing users to listen to both subtle sounds and powerful explosions for a more immersive audio experience. To do so the card leverages on the expertise of Audio Note UK, being built using audio-grade capacitors and resistors installed on a silver- and gold-plated multilayer PCB. Further improving quality are isolated dual-ground planes for analogue and digital circuitry, while the power supply promises to be both low noise and regulated.

Belkin Presents USB-C to Lightning Cable

Belkin launches the BoostCharge range of cables at CES 2019, with the most interesting product being USB-C to Lightning cables, the first made by the company to receive official approval from Apple itself.

The Boost Charge line also includes a USB-A to Lightning cable, as well as a USB-A to USB-C option. All cables promise increased durability and strength, and include a leather strap to prevent tangles and help in organisation. The cables come in a black and white speckled design, and are available in 1.2, 1.8 and 3m lengths.

Razer Presents Raiju Mobile Controller

Customers wanting a game controller for Android smartphones get a Razer option-- the Raiju Mobile comes complete with a rotating stand, allowing one to slot in their handset and play games with console-style controls.

As the name might suggest, the Raiju Mobile is based on the Raiju, a PS4 controller from the company. It features the same design, with 4 re-mappable "mecha-tactile action" buttons, a hair trigger mode for rapid fire and a dedicated mode switch button for switching connectivity modes and paired devices.

A Professional-Style Razer Keyboard

Razer is best known for gaming hardware replete with garish stylings and plenty of RGB lighting-- making the BlackWidow Lite, a minimalist mechanical keyboard in a matte shade of black, something of a surprise.

Technically a more "executive" version of the BlackWidow gaming keyboard, the BlackWidow Lite promises "near-silent, tactile feedback" through the use of Razer Orange switches. In case users want to cut down the noise even further, the keyboard also includes additional rubber o-rings. The keys promise an 80-million keystroke lifespan, as well as 10-key rollover with anti-ghosting.
